Senior Crime Solicitor – Manchester City Centre

Competitive base salary + generous bonus scheme

We are working with a Tier 1 Legal 500-ranked and Chambers-recognised firm to recruit an experienced Senior Crime Solicitor to join their multi-award-winning expert team in their modern Manchester office.

This is a predominantly privately funded client role, focusing on pre-charge advice, engagement, and the charging process in serious criminal matters. No duty status required.


Key Responsibilities

  • Managing a diverse caseload of criminal defence matters for both private and publicly funded clients
  • Attending court hearings and representing clients at police stations
  • Conducting advocacy in Magistrates Court
  • Mentoring and supervising junior lawyers and trainees
  • Preparing clear, accurate legal advice and documentation
  • Liaising with clients, courts, and third parties to streamline case progression
  • Ensuring compliance with regulatory and quality standards

Ideal Candidate Requirements

  • Solicitor with at least 3 years' PQE (preferably in Crime)—strong criminal defence experience essential
  • Solid background in Criminal Investigations and Defence strategies
  • Exceptional communication and client care skills
  • In-depth knowledge of Criminal Law and court procedures
  • Ability to manage caseloads and meet tight deadlines
  • Proficiency in Legal IT systems & strong organisational skills
  • Proactive, team-oriented mindset with a commitment to continuous development
